## Step 4: Migrate the Tilefort cache layer

Before cutting over to Tilefort 3.x, drain the legacy tile-rendering cache on each render node. The new layer shards cached tiles by zoom band rather than region, so stale entries from 2.x will never be hit and only waste disk. Run the drain script during the low-traffic window, confirm eviction counters reach zero, then restart the renderers. Apply the following configuration values to every node in the Tilefort pool before restart.

deployment values, kajep-kageg:
[praix]
host = praix.paliqcorp.corp
user = praix_svc
database = praix_prod

**Retrying Failed Exports (Corvid Export API)**

Failed exports in Corvid are retried automatically up to three times with exponential backoff. After the third failure, the job moves to a dead-letter state and must be resubmitted via the `/exports/retry` endpoint. Manual retries require authentication against the internal export-admin service. For review purposes, the staging key is provided here:

API key for tajop-tagaf: zpat15_wFKIn9d85K88goH

Handover note — Marta to Deniz

Quick one before I'm off: the Q3 budget request for the Larkspur tooling upgrade is drafted but not yet submitted to the board. Figures are sanity-checked with finance; contingency sits at 8%. Push it at the next session. Context for the board is below.

board note of kagep-yahig: Only 9 of the 120 pilot accounts renewed Quenix, so a churn review is set for April 1.